Analysis
The most recent figure for fertility rate vs. share living in extreme poverty in Falkland Islands is 1.69 live births per woman, measured in 2023.
That represents a change of down 0.3% on the previous year and down 0.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, fertility rate vs. share living in extreme poverty in Falkland Islands peaked at 3.23 live births per woman in 1960 and was at its lowest, 1.46 live births per woman, in 1994.
That places Falkland Islands 141st out of 236 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 74 years of available data.

About this data
Total fertility rate: the average number of children a woman would have if she experienced the year's age-specific birth rates throughout her childbearing years.
